A guide to uninstall mBlock from your PC

mBlock is a software application. This page holds details on how to uninstall it from your PC. It is produced by Maker Works Technology Co. Ltd.,. You can find out more on Maker Works Technology Co. Ltd., or check for application updates here. Please follow if you want to read more on mBlock on Maker Works Technology Co. Ltd.,'s website. mBlock is commonly install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\mBlock folder, but this location may vary a lot depending on the user's decision while installing the program. mBlock's full uninstall command line is C:\Program Files (x86)\mBlock\unins000.exe. The application's main executable file is titled mBlock.exe and its approximative size is 220.00 KB (225280 bytes).
